There are artists who sing to be heard, and then there are artists like Nate Hicks—those who sing because the world needs their truth. Emerging from Toledo, Ohio by way of Atlanta, Georgia, Nate carries a musical language shaped by real-life grit, emotion, and lived experience. His artistry was born in high school hallways, where curiosity turned into craft, and craft soon evolved into a vocation that feels less like ambition and more like destiny.
What makes Nate remarkable is not just his talent—though his ability to sing, rap, write, and perform across genres is undeniable—it’s the way he channels something deeply human and unguarded. Performing came naturally to him, but connection became the mission. In every room he enters, from electrifying city stages to intimate streaming spaces, Nate doesn’t just entertain; he reaches people. He cracks open moments of vulnerability, threads stories of love, family, healing, and truth, and turns them into something listeners feel in their bones.

His EPs “Road Trips” and “Intentions”, alongside singles like The Way That I Want You, reveal an artist who refuses to hide behind the music—he pours himself into it. These songs are extensions of his perspective, fragments of memory, and reflections of a man learning, loving, questioning, and rising. Whether in Michigan, Florida, or Jamaica, Nate leaves crowds buzzing with the echo of something authentic and unapologetically real.
And then—there is Nate Hicks, the Firefighter/EMT.
While many artists write about saving themselves, Nate wakes up every day and saves others. Between sirens, shifts, and life-or-death moments, he still finds room for melody, creativity, and passion. That duality—protector by day, performer by soul—adds a profound weight to his music. You hear the courage. You hear the empathy. You hear the lived-in honesty of a man who has seen the world’s fragility and still chooses love.
His artistic curiosities stretch across the performing arts, and he embraces collaborations that push him outside comfort zones and into new dimensions. Nate Hicks is not just an artist in motion—he is an artist in evolution.
